In a groundbreaking announcement this week, Qualcomm unveiled its plan to acquire Modular Inc., a software development company specializing in AI-native technologies, for a staggering $3.9 billion. This acquisition is not merely a financial transaction; it represents a significant shift in Qualcomm's strategy to enhance its offerings in the dynamic realm of data centers.

Understanding the Implications of the Acquisition

The acquisition aims to establish a silicon-agnostic compute layer that is adaptable across various devices, edge environments, and data centers. Qualcomm's CEO emphasized that this initiative would improve performance-per-watt, provide greater hardware flexibility, and foster an open developer ecosystem. This is crucial as organizations increasingly rely on diverse AI solutions.
